There’s a butterfly effect to benevolence in our community. At Columbus Baptist Church, our benevolence outreach is the Good Neighbor Store. It’s more than just an act of kindness; it is charitable activities, volunteering, and general goodwill. Through our store, we look beyond the needs of the church to foster empathy and compassion for those in need throughout Polk County.
The Good Neighbor Store is a transformative opportunity to strengthen social bonds, inspire hope, and encourage kindness. And the work we do at the store provides a greater sense of purpose and fulfillment.
The Butterfly Effect of Generosity
Small acts can lead to life-changing outcomes for those in need. With a single act of kindness, many are inspired, creating a chain reaction that strengthens the community’s social fabric.
Thrift shopping is a lifestyle choice that brings a host of benefits. Come to the Good Neighbor Store for the thrill of the hunt, unbelievable finds at incredible savings. And the best part is that you’re making an active, positive impact on our community.
Good Neighbor Store uses 100% of its proceeds to fund the benevolence programs of Columbus Baptist Church. When you shop at our store, you are changing lives in our community.
